Redis优势与不足全面解析,网友热议:性能卓越但内存消耗大

文章导读
最近,关于Redis的讨论在技术社区持续发酵。2023年10月,有网友在论坛上分享称,其团队在使用Redis处理实时数据时,虽然响应速度极快,但内存占用飙升,不得不频繁优化数据结构。同期,某云服务商发布报告指出,Redis在缓存场景下的性能依然领先,但内存成本成为用户关注焦点。这些消息反映了Redis在实际应用中的两面性。
📋 目录
  1. Redis优势与不足全面解析,网友热议:性能卓越但内存消耗大
  2. Redis的优势:为什么它如此受欢迎
  3. Redis的不足:内存消耗大的挑战
  4. 适用场景与用户热议
A A

Redis优势与不足全面解析,网友热议:性能卓越但内存消耗大

最近,关于Redis的讨论在技术社区持续发酵。2023年10月,有网友在论坛上分享称,其团队在使用Redis处理实时数据时,虽然响应速度极快,但内存占用飙升,不得不频繁优化数据结构。同期,某云服务商发布报告指出,Redis在缓存场景下的性能依然领先,但内存成本成为用户关注焦点。这些消息反映了Redis在实际应用中的两面性。

Redis的优势:为什么它如此受欢迎

Redis的最大亮点是性能卓越。它基于内存操作,读写速度极快,每秒能处理数十万次请求,这让它在需要快速响应的场景中脱颖而出,比如网站会话缓存、实时排行榜或消息队列。此外,Redis支持多种数据结构,如字符串、列表、哈希表等,灵活性很高,开发者可以根据需求选择合适的数据类型。它还具备持久化功能,可以将数据保存到磁盘,防止重启后丢失。这些特性使得Redis成为许多项目的首选工具,尤其在高并发环境下。如果你想进一步探索这些功能,不妨试试开发工具箱,里面可能有助你更高效地使用Redis。

Redis的不足:内存消耗大的挑战

尽管性能出色,Redis的不足也很明显。最常被诟病的是内存消耗大。由于数据存储在内存中,当数据量增长时,内存占用会迅速增加,导致成本上升。相比之下,传统数据库将数据放在硬盘上,内存需求更低。另外,Redis在持久化方面可能存在风险:如果配置不当,在服务器故障时可能导致数据丢失。它的功能也相对有限,不像关系型数据库那样支持复杂的查询或事务处理。网友热议中,不少用户提到,他们必须定期监控内存使用情况,并采用淘汰策略来释放空间。

Redis优势与不足全面解析,网友热议:性能卓越但内存消耗大

适用场景与用户热议

综合来看,Redis最适合需要高速读写的场景,比如缓存、实时分析和消息传递。但用户们普遍认为,在选择Redis时,必须权衡性能与资源消耗。一些网友建议,对于大数据量应用,可以结合其他存储方案,比如用Redis处理热点数据,而将历史数据转移到磁盘数据库。还有用户分享经验说,通过优化数据结构和设置过期时间,能有效减少内存压力。总的来说,Redis是一个强大的工具,但并非万能,关键是根据具体需求来合理使用。

引用来源:技术论坛讨论(2023年10月)、云服务商报告(2023年)、Redis官方文档及用户实践分享。